Python for Game Development

Python is a high-level, interpreted programming language that is known for its simplicity and readability. Python is widely used in game development due to its ease of use and quick development time. Python allows developers to create prototypes and test ideas quickly, which is essential in the game development process.

Python also has several game development libraries, such as Pygame, Panda3D, and PyOpenGL, which allow developers to create 2D and 3D games easily. Pygame is a popular library for creating 2D games, while Panda3D and PyOpenGL allow developers to create 3D games with ease.

Furthermore, Python’s syntax is easy to learn and understand, making it an excellent language for beginners. Python’s clean syntax and structure make it easy to read and maintain code, which is essential in the game development process.

C++ for Game Development

C++ is a powerful, high-performance programming language that is widely used in game development. C++ is known for its speed and efficiency, making it an excellent choice for developing high-performance games.

C++ also has several game development libraries, such as OpenGL, DirectX, and SFML, which allow developers to create 2D and 3D games with ease. OpenGL and DirectX are popular libraries for creating 3D games, while SFML is an excellent library for creating 2D games.

C++ has a steeper learning curve compared to Python, but it offers more control and flexibility, which is essential in game development. C++ also allows developers to optimize code for performance, which is crucial in creating high-performance games.

What are the Popular Libraries and Frameworks Used in Python Game Development?

Python has several libraries and frameworks that are popularly used in game development. Some of these libraries and frameworks include:

  • Pygame: Pygame is a set of Python modules that are used for game development. Pygame provides functionality for graphics, sound, and user input.
  • Arcade: Arcade is an easy-to-use Python library for creating 2D arcade games. Arcade provides functionality for graphics, sound, and user input.
  • Panda3D: Panda3D is a 3D game engine that is written in Python and C++. Panda3D provides functionality for rendering, physics, and user input.

Python:

Python is a high-level, interpreted programming language that is known for its simplicity and ease of use. It is widely used in data science, machine learning, and web development. Python has a large community of developers and a vast number of libraries and frameworks that make game development easier.

Python’s simplicity and readability make it a great language for game development. It has a clean syntax that is easy to read and understand. Python is also a dynamically typed language, which means that you don’t have to declare variables before using them. This makes it easier to write code and reduces the time it takes to develop a game.

C#:

C# is a modern, object-oriented programming language developed by Microsoft. It is widely used for Windows desktop and mobile app development, game development, and web development. C# has a large community of developers and a vast number of libraries and frameworks that make game development easier.

C# is a statically typed language, which means that you have to declare variables before using them. This can make the code more verbose and time-consuming to write. However, C# has strong type checking, which makes it easier to catch errors before they occur.

Python for Game Development

Python is a high-level programming language that is easy to learn and use. It is a popular choice for game development because of its simplicity, flexibility, and ease of use. Python has a large number of libraries and frameworks that make it ideal for game development. Some of the popular game engines that use Python include Pygame, Panda3D, and PyOgre.

Pygame is a popular game engine that is built on top of Python. It is a simple and easy-to-use library that provides a range of features for game development. Pygame has a number of modules that allow you to create 2D games, add sound effects, and handle user input. It is a great choice for beginners who want to learn game development.

Panda3D is another popular game engine that is built on top of Python. It is a powerful and flexible engine that provides a range of features for game development. Panda3D has a number of modules that allow you to create 3D games, add physics, and handle networking. It is a great choice for advanced game developers who want to create complex games.

PyOgre is a game engine that is built on top of Python and the Ogre 3D graphics engine. It provides a range of features for game development, including 3D rendering, physics, and animation. PyOgre is a great choice for developers who want to create high-quality 3D games.

Java for Game Development

Java is a popular programming language that is widely used for game development. It is a versatile language that is used for a range of applications, including game development. Java has a large number of libraries and frameworks that make it ideal for game development. Some of the popular game engines that use Java include jMonkeyEngine, LibGDX, and LWJGL.

jMonkeyEngine is a popular game engine that is built on top of Java. It provides a range of features for game development, including 3D rendering, physics, and animation. jMonkeyEngine is a great choice for developers who want to create high-quality 3D games.

LibGDX is a game development framework that is built on top of Java. It provides a range of features for game development, including 2D and 3D rendering, physics, and animation. LibGDX is a great choice for developers who want to create cross-platform games.

LWJGL is a lightweight game development library that is built on top of Java. It provides a range of features for game development, including 3D rendering, input handling, and audio. LWJGL is a great choice for developers who want to create high-performance games.
